- An easy to follow tutorial on how to change the out dated lights on a 3rd Gen 4runner dashboard to LED. This was done in a 1998, other years may vary.
TOOLS:
Ratcheting Wrench
10mm socket
12mm socket
#2 Philips Screwdriver
Bulbs
Cluster - # 194 LED Bulb x4
Climate Control and Ash Tray - # 74 LED Bulb x4

Those 74 bulbs work, but require soldering. Didn't know you can only solder it to one half of the LED on each side. I blobbed it the first time and diagnosing what went wrong in itself was frustrating and took a lot of back tracing. Turned out it arcs and I kept blowing the 10A fuse under the hood. Resoldered it surgically and its all good now. Thank you so much for the tear down, I haven't had working lights on my climate for a few years and it was kind of dangerous at night searching!

99 to 2002 uses T-5 bulbs, it did not light up the same way as the older clusters like the one you did. When my bulb lights up it focuses too much light on the one spot and does not disperse it very well at all. The console light was ok to do, that used the same T5 bulbs.

#74 like the ignition ring. But the cluster has green plastic over the arrows, so you can't change the color.
Warning lights should be replaced with incandescent bulbs because you can't test them to make sure the bulb is inserted correctly.
